EA Sports FC 25 are set to introduce a controversial game changing feature which will cause chaos in online matches.
It's that time of the year where fans are given their first preview of what the new game will look like and some of the new features that will be introduced.
Jude Bellingham was announced as this year’s cover star and the official trailer was released at the start of the week.
Before it has even hit shelves, many have complained about the game with some stating that there’s not enough changes from previous versions.
However, according to Epic Games, players will now be able to commit professional fouls for the first time.
Fouls have been in the game for a few years but this time, you'll be able to stop your opponent going through on goal - much to their annoyance.
When an opposition player is running through, there will be an option to deliberately pull them down, earning a yellow card.
On a PlayStation controller it will be possible by pressing ‘R2’ and ‘X’ or the right trigger, whilst on the Xbox controller it’s possible by pressing ‘A’.
While some fouls in the game go unpunished, these will always result in a yellow card and if committed more than once by the same player, you can expect to be sent off.
Since professional fouls are a key part of the real game, EA have tried to bring that across into the virtual world of football.

Other changes include the 4-3-2-1 formation being removed as well as three positions, including the centre-forward position.
The game will be released on September 27, 2024.
